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
74826024987 073623 57120919197 710
28188437 645
28188437 645
0987261 59648287 420 5176 6303734
All about undefined
Interested in learning more?
28188437 645
0987261 59648287 420 5176 6303734
See more
277986642 47 95
430 54154072 4775386260
See more
72492844822 3876366 24775538354
01 673 01774 61342130243
See more